**See yourself in our team**

Corporate Affairs coordinates and oversees internal and external communications, media relations, events and government and industry affairs. Our role is to earn trust by advancing CBA’s reputation through advocacy with internal and external stakeholders and to deliver advice and insights to inform decisions.

**Do work that matters**

We are looking for a creative and innovative content producer to support a newly formed Newsroom team critical in driving CBA’s communications with external stakeholders.

**Your responsibilities**:

- **Editorial strategy**: Plan, prioritise, and produce key stories, analysis, and content to deliver the Newsroom strategy. Help drive editorial meetings and make decisions on resource allocation and delivery plans across owned and earned channels.
- **Editorial creation**: Plan and produce informative finance and economics news, analysis and explainers on relevant topics.
- **Channel and data management**:Oversee back-end production, set key performance indicators, use data to inform decisions and drive improvement, and establish feedback loops to measure content effectiveness for audiences.
- **Training and counsel**: Advise and help lead editorial best-practice among the wider team as the skillset and priorities shift to more original story production.
- **Risk management**: Role model risk culture.

**Your skills and experience**:

- Outstanding storytelling skills across text and multimedia, with an ability to adjust style and tone for different audiences.
- Thorough understanding of the Australian news and social media information ecosystem, as well as the economic and political landscape.
- Demonstrated success working in fast-paced content production, news, and/or political environments.
- Proven ability to engage and build digital audiences across owned and social media, and work across a range of content management and workflow systems, including Adobe, Salesforce and JIRA.
- Ability to translate complex data and issues into compelling content for different stakeholders.
- Proficiency in video editing, photography, and related multimedia and visual content creation skills, as well as website analytics platforms, is an advantage.
- Comprehensive experience working with AI tools, and a willingness to develop these capabilities to benefit audience outcomes.
- Strong business acumen, understanding of the banking and financial services sector, and corporate affairs / public relations experience preferred.
- Proven ability to proactively identify, understand, discuss, and act on current and future risks.
- Bachelor's degree in Communications, Economics, Business/Commerce, Journalism or similar.
